Exclusivity and ownership of heraldry, blazons and coats of arms related to Mangulin

Traditionally, the privilege of possessing a coat of arms is reserved for a particular person with the surname Mangulin, without automatically extending it to all individuals who share that surname. The right to use a specific coat of arms design is transmitted in accordance with the laws and customs of heraldry, which implies that not all bearers of the surname Mangulin have the heraldic right to use the coat of arms linked to their ancestors.< /p>

Exploring the connection between the coat of arms and the lineage of the Mangulin family

The relationship between the heraldic shield and Mangulin is fascinating in its complexity. Initially, coats of arms were awarded to specific individuals rather than entire families, and were tied to the person who had received them because of their achievements, military exploits, or social standing. Over time, the Mangulin crest became hereditary, becoming a distinctive emblem of the family lineage and establishing a lasting connection with the Mangulin surname.
